Bellagio Fountain Spectacles

The Bellagio fountain show remains one of the most iconic free attractions in Las Vegas. I’ve watched these choreographed water performances multiple times, and they never lose their magic.

From 3pm to 8pm, the fountains dance every 30 minutes. After 8pm until midnight, the frequency increases to every 15 minutes. This timing allows for multiple viewing opportunities throughout your evening.

When the roadside gets crowded with thousands of spectators, I head to the footbridge from Bellagio for better views. The 1,200 nozzles create a breathtaking water ballet synchronized to music.

Dueling Piano Bars and Live Music

Harrah’s Casino hosts a fantastic Dueling Piano Bar that starts at 9pm nightly. Talented pianists sing, play, and take requests with no cover charge.

I particularly enjoy catching the twin sister pianists who add playful sibling rivalry to their performances. Fremont Street Experience offers free live music concerts every night from 6pm under a massive LED canopy.

For night owls, South Point Casino presents the “Dirty 12:30” comedy show. This R-rated performance provides laughs without any drink minimum requirements.

Gondola Rides and Paris Hotel’s Eiffel Tower

The Venetian hotel transports you to Italy with indoor gondola rides along picturesque canals. Singing gondoliers punt guests beneath bridges and a painted sky ceiling.

While the gondola experience costs money, watching the performances is completely free. Nearby, the Paris Hotel features a half-scale Eiffel Tower replica offering stunning observation deck views.

Art and Ambiance at Bellagio Conservatory

The Bellagio Conservatory showcases breathtaking seasonal floral arrangements crafted by over 100 horticulturalists. This stunning atrium transforms throughout the year with elaborate botanical displays.

For peaceful refuge, the Wynn Botanical Gardens feature remarkable floral sculptures like hot air balloons and life-size carousels made from real flowers. The Aria hotel complements this with an impressive modern art collection turning the property into a walkable gallery.

Elvis-Themed Weddings and Surprises

I stumbled upon a downtown wedding chapel where a couple invited me to watch their Elvis-themed vow renewal. This spontaneous invitation created one of my most memorable Las Vegas moments. The wedding chapel district offers opportunities to witness these entertaining ceremonies completely free.

Just a short walk away, Downtown Container Park transforms 40 shipping containers into a quirky shopping and entertainment district. A 40-foot fire-breathing praying mantis sculpture welcomes visitors to this unconventional space.

The park features small boutiques and off-beat stores creating an alternative shopping way. Free entertainment includes short films projected onto theatre ceilings with music and light shows.

This area sits close to the Mob Museum and Neon Museum, making it easy to combine multiple things. The best Las Vegas experiences often come from wandering into unexpected performances or discovering hidden attractions.

Hoover Dam and Grand Canyon Excursions

The Hoover Dam stands as a historic engineering achievement. Completed two years ahead of schedule, it created Lake Mead, America’s largest manmade reservoir.

Walking across the Pat Tillman Memorial Bridge offers spectacular views of this massive structure. Many visitors combine this day trip with a visit to the Grand Canyon.

This combination creates an unforgettable adventure showcasing both human ingenuity and natural beauty. Guided tour options handle transportation while providing expert commentary.

Hiking Red Rock Canyon

Just 30 minutes from the city, Red Rock Canyon features stunning sandstone formations and ancient petroglyphs. Hikers might spot wildlife like tarantulas along the trails.

Valley of Fire State Park sits less than an hour away, offering similar desert beauty. Both locations work well for half-day or full-day excursions.

Renting a car provides flexibility for your road trip, while organized tours offer convenience. Either way, you’ll experience Nevada’s breathtaking landscapes beyond the city limits.

Nightlife and Unexpected Live Performances

The Fashion Show Mall presents free fashion shows on an enormous runway, broadcast on massive screens throughout the complex. These productions rival professional runway shows.

Circus Circus offers a spectacular free one-hour circus show featuring professional trapeze artists and jugglers. This family-friendly entertainment provides unforgettable memories.

At Silverton Aquarium, you can catch free mermaid performances throughout the day. The venue even offers Mermaid School for both adults and children.

Caesar’s Palace hosts the Fall of Atlantis show featuring animatronic statues with 400 moving parts. This immersive experience runs Thursdays through Mondays every hour.

Area15 delivers cutting-edge entertainment with VR experiences, axe throwing, and Meow Wolf’s Omega Mart installation. This interactive art space transforms a grocery store concept into something truly extraordinary.

Wynn Botanical Gardens vs. Ethel M Botanical Cactus Garden

The Wynn’s displays include breathtaking creations like hot air balloons and carousels made entirely from flowers. Meanwhile, the Ethel M Chocolate Factory’s cactus garden presents a completely different world of desert beauty.

This three-acre garden features over 300 species of cactus arranged in stunning natural landscapes. Visitors can combine this with free factory tours watching chocolate production.

The Flamingo Wildlife Habitat provides a free four-acre sanctuary featuring exotic birds and aquatic life. This peaceful escape sits right on the Strip yet feels worlds away from the casinos.

For art enthusiasts, the Marjorie Barrick Museum offers rotating exhibitions on the university campus. The Pinball Hall of Fame houses the world‘s largest collection of vintage machines.

The Shelby Heritage Center beautifully preserves automotive history with over thirty classic cars on display.

Park MGM Promenade offers one best alternative to casino interiors. This outdoor space connects multiple resorts with lush greenery, waterfall walls, and unique dining options. The illuminated 40-foot Bliss Dance statue creates a stunning centerpiece for this pedestrian-friendly area.

Unique Attractions at Downtown Container Park

Downtown Container Park exemplifies Las Vegas’ creative spirit. Shipping containers transform into boutique shops and eateries beneath a fire-breathing praying mantis sculpture. This space provides Instagram-worthy entertainment completely separate from casinos.

The Museum of Illusions features mind-bending exhibits that warp perspective. Both adults and children enjoy optical illusions in interactive rooms. This attraction represents one best example of Vegas’ diverse entertainment options.

Speakeasies have become prevalent throughout the city. The Cosmopolitan alone houses five hidden bars behind unassuming doors. Discovering these intimate spaces offers craft cocktails in settings that contrast sharply with massive casino environments.

Free Casino Lessons and Card Game Demos

I discovered that major casinos provide daily instructional sessions for beginners. Circus Circus offers blackjack at 10:30am, followed by roulette and craps lessons.

Excalibur schedules multiple daily sessions including poker at 11am and evening classes. Golden Nugget covers five different games starting at 10am each morning.

Strategies for Free Drinks and Table Tips

Sitting at busy, high-value tables increases cocktail server frequency. I recommend tipping $5-20 for your first round to establish premium service.

Standard tipping afterward is $1 per drink. Casino Royale offers a unique $20 refundable card program for essentially risk-free gambling experiences.

Photo-Worthy Spots Like the Welcome Sign and High Roller

The iconic Welcome to Las Vegas sign sits further south than most visitors expect. You’ll find it behind Mandalay Bay Hotel, nearly opposite the Pinball Museum.

Arrive early to avoid long queues at this popular landmark. I often sneak up the side for unique angle shots that capture the sign without crowds.

The LINQ Promenade offers excellent walking experiences with the High Roller observation wheel at its far end. While tickets are required to ride, you can photograph the massive wheel and watch zip liners overhead for free.

Navigating the LINQ Promenade and Pedestrian Bridges

This pedestrian shopping street outside Harrah’s features restaurants and shops perfect for casual exploration. The elevated footbridges provide stunning views of the entire Strip.

For special events, New Year’s Eve transforms the four-mile Strip into a massive block party. Up to 300,000 people celebrate under choreographed fireworks launched from hotel rooftops.

Remember that open containers are legal on Las Vegas Strip sidewalks for those 21+. Fremont Street maintains stricter regulations, so plan accordingly.
